WebNov 11, 2024 · EIN Lookup for Nonprofit and Exempt Organizations Information pertaining to exempt organizations is available to the public. The IRS website has a specialized tool for performing a search on exempt organizations. Use the Exempt Organization Select Check to search for an organization by name.
WebEach chapter of a national non-profit organization must have its own EIN, but the central organization may file for a group tax exemption. WebNov 21, 2024 · If you're an international applicant and don't have a legal residence or place of business in the U.S., you can apply for an EIN by one of these methods: Telephone:(267) 941-1099 (available Monday through Friday from 6 a.m. to 11 p.m. Eastern time) Fax:(855) 215-1627 if within the U.S., or (304) 707-9471 if outside the U.S.
